Page 1 of 2

Ryzom merkt sich die Auflösung nicht

Posted: Sat Feb 24, 2007 8:36 pm
by janimaku
Moin Moin
obwohl ich die AUflösung von 1280x800 bei jedem Neustart einstelle und auch schon x-Mal in der ryzom_configuration_rd.exe eingestellt habe, resettet sich die Auflösung des Vollbilds ständig (immerhin auch berechenbar und beständig).
In der client.cfg steht die Auflösung seit eh und je richtig drinnen. Nur in der client_default.cfg stehen folgende Einträge:

FullScreen = 1;
Width = 1024;
Height = 768;

wenn ich sie manuell auf den richtigen Wert setzte ist alles in Ordnung. Aber das jedesmal zu machen ist noch aufwendiger als im Spiel am Anfang immer auf System->Konfiguration->Ansicht zu gehen und da die Auflösung zu ändern.

Ich habe die Version aus dem Netz - ca. 3 Wochen alt und das Problem habe ich seit anbeginn.

Vielen Dank,
Janimaku

Re: Ryzom merkt sich die Auflösung nicht

Posted: Sat Feb 24, 2007 8:49 pm
by jonasq
Als Walkaround:
bau dir ne bat-datei die deine client_config in den ryzom ordner kopiert und dann das game startet und starte über diese bat.

Mikira

Re: Ryzom merkt sich die Auflösung nicht

Posted: Sat Feb 24, 2007 11:33 pm
by janimaku
Moin
paar Fragen:
1. welche .cfg meinst du jetzt. Ich nehme an die client_default.cfg, denn eine client_config gibt es bei mir nicht, jedenfalls weder im Ryzom-Ordner noch im cfg-Ordner. Ich kenne keine client_config.*
2. Falls du die client.cfg meinst: die liegt ja eh im Ryzom-Verzeichnis.
3. Ich verstehe das Ganze nicht so ganz im speziellen:
-sollen die .cfg s aus dem cfg Ordner in den Ryzom-Ordner kopiert werden?
-wenn ich ein externes Backup in den Ryzom-Ordner lade überschreibe ich da nicht Dateien, und wenn ich das tue, gehen dann nicht meine gespeicherten Änderungen ingame weg, wenn ich die batch ausführe? Dann kann ich sie ja auch gleich schreibschützen - ich suche ja gerade nach einer eleganten Lösung mit der alles so ist wie es sein soll.
Ein vielleicht nicht ganz unwichtige Information: Ich hänge hier vor einem Turion X2 -Doppelkern Prozessor.
Danke,
Janimaku

Re: Ryzom merkt sich die Auflösung nicht

Posted: Sun Feb 25, 2007 9:03 am
by jonasq
Okay, ich war da nicht ganz korrekt:

ich meinte die client.cfg

Wenn du deine Einstellungen über die Konfiguration vornimmst, dürfte diese Datei ja deine 1280x800 enthalten.
Diese sicherst du dir, indem du sie zB umbenennst in client.cf

Warum?

Weil Ryzom deine Einstellung beim beenden (nehme ich an) mit dem 1280x1024 überschreibt. Also haben wir nun ein Backup deiner Einstellung.

Nun machst dir eine Bat datei mit dem Inhalt
----
copy client.cf client.cfg /y
start client_ryzom_rd.exe
----
( /y fragt das Überschreiben nicht nach)
Speicherst das Ganze unter ryzom.bat, legst dir nen Shorcut aufn Desktop und startest über diesen das Spiel.

Was tut das?

Die aktuelle client.cfg mit deiner gesicherten client.cf überschreiben, und dir zu jedem Start die 1280x800 einzustellen.
Danach startet die bat noch das Game.

Dürfte so klappen wie beschrieben, viel Spaß auf 1280x800 :)

ich hoffe, ich werd verstanden :)
Mikira

Re: Ryzom merkt sich die Auflösung nicht

Posted: Sun Feb 25, 2007 3:52 pm
by janimaku
Moin
erstmal danke für deine Mühen.
Ich nehme an, dass du die client_default.cfg backupen willst, da nur dort die Einträge ja falsch sind.
Ich bin jetzt einen Schritt weiter bei der Fehlersuche - kann mit dem Fehler aber nicht so viel anfangen (so ähnlich wie Windows: Sie haben einen Fehler bei 0x111111 ;-) oder Java.lang.Nullpointerexception ;-) ):

2007/02/25 16:45:04 INF ad8 client_ryzom_rd.exe login_patch.cpp 481 : BNP Zwangsentpackung : Schecksumme stimmt nicht überein : client_default.cfg

gefunden in der log.log
Mit anderen Worten: er scheint meine selbstgeänderte client_default.cfg nicht mehr zu mögen ;-(
ich probiers gleich nochmal mit der client.cfg

Danke,
Janimaku

P.S: Die Schecksumme - lol

Re: Ryzom merkt sich die Auflösung nicht

Posted: Sun Feb 25, 2007 8:06 pm
by firehh
nein es ist die client.cfg gemeint denn nur diese beinhaltet die vom user gemachten einstellungen.

die client_default.cfg wird bei jedem start von ryzom überprüft und sollte sie nicht die default werte enthalten wird sie wieder mit den richtigen default werten gepatcht / überschrieben.

also achte drauf das ryzom in die client.cfg schreiben kann.

anderer punkt mit dem vollbild wird das spiel nur im fenster gestartet ?

dann klick einfach auf maximieren das sollte ausreichen damit das spiel automatisch nach der char auswahl wieder in den vollbildmodus wechselt.

Re: Ryzom merkt sich die Auflösung nicht

Posted: Sun Feb 25, 2007 8:27 pm
by hellen
in der client_default gibts doch nen eintrag der sagt ob die client.cfg überschrieben werden soll oder ned, kontrollier den wert mal und setz ihn auf nicht überschrieben

Re: Ryzom merkt sich die Auflösung nicht

Posted: Sun Feb 25, 2007 8:41 pm
by oneof1
hellen wrote:in der client_default gibts doch nen eintrag der sagt ob die client.cfg überschrieben werden soll oder ned, kontrollier den wert mal und setz ihn auf nicht überschrieben
die "client_default.cfg" kann man nicht verändern!
um zu erreichen, dass der SOR-Client die client.cfg nicht überschreibt muss man die diese die Zeile "SaveConfig = 0;" eintragen (ohne "").

Re: Ryzom merkt sich die Auflösung nicht

Posted: Sun Feb 25, 2007 11:53 pm
by jonasq
janimaku wrote:ich probiers gleich nochmal mit der client.cfg
Die war ja auch gemeint.
Das "default" in client_default.cfg steht nicht für "frei modifizierbar", sondern ist eben, wie oben beschrieben die Standardeinstellung, die überall starten sollte (ja, sollte...) :rolleyes: .

Und die Schecksumme... das ist wohl die Summe, die Nevrax von dir haben will, daß es dennoch läuft :D

Ist nicht der erste Fettnapf, was Übersetzungen angeht, siehe auch der Link in meiner Sig zu diesem Thema^^

Mikira

Re: Ryzom merkt sich die Auflösung nicht

Posted: Thu Mar 15, 2007 8:47 am
by gazzi
Hiho,

wollte mal Fragen, obs dafür schon eine Lösung gibt. Habe auch das Auflösungsproblem, da ich mit einem 16:10 Monitor spiele:

In der client.cfg stehts richtig drin (Ryzom nicht gestartet):
ScreenAspectRatio = 1.6000000238;
Width = 1680;
Height = 1050;

In der client_default.cfg steht unter Window Config:
SaveConfig = 1;
Width = 1024;
Height = 768;

Wenn ich mich einlogge, ist die aspect ratio unter Konfiguration allerdings 0.000001. Muss sie immer auf 1.6 umstellen, das ich nicht alles "zusammengestaucht" sehe.

Das Kopieren der client.cfg mittels Batch-Datei bringt nix, da dort ja schon beim Start die richtigen Werte drinstehen / Beim Beenden die Werte nicht überschrieben werden.

Hat es schon einer mit nem 16:10er Monitor hinbekommen Ryzom im Vollbild mit richtiger Auflösung zu starten? Wenn ja -Wie?